Understanding the process of a professional installation

First, the team grinds down the concrete to open up the pores and remove old paint or debris. This mechanical preparation is the most important part because it ensures the resin actually bites into the surface.

Next, they fill in those annoying pits and cracks with a high-strength patch material that hardens quickly. A smooth base means your final result will look perfectly flat and even across the entire room.

Then, they roll or squeegee the base coat directly into the prepared concrete to create a deep bond. This layer acts as the foundation for the decorative flakes or solid colors you decide to pick out.

Lastly, a clear top coat seals everything in to provide that deep, glass-like finish you see in high-end showrooms. This top layer provides the wear resistance needed to survive your toughest garage projects for many years.

Epoxy floor coating is a multi-coat resin system applied directly over a prepared slab. The chemistry bonds at a molecular level with the concrete and cures into a rigid, chemical-resistant surface several times harder than the slab beneath.

Contractor applying epoxy coating

Most modern systems are 80 to 100 mil thick once cured. The visual hallmark is a glossy mirror finish, often with decorative flake or metallic. Beyond the look, the slab is now sealed: motor oil, brake fluid, road salt and acid spills wipe off instead of soaking in.

Installation process in Stacyville, Iowa

Metallic flake epoxy detail
  1. Phone quote.Square footage, slab condition, finish preference. Most quotes are firm after one call and a couple of photos.
  2. Surface prep.Diamond grinding or shot blasting opens the pores. Cracks routed and filled. This is where most failed coatings fail, installers in Stacyville and the surrounding area do not skip it.
  3. Coats applied.Primer, basecoat, flake or metallic broadcast, then a UV-stable topcoat. Professional-grade two-part resins.
  4. Cure and handover.Foot-traffic in 24 hours, vehicles in 72. Before-and-after photos and warranty paperwork delivered with the keys.

How much does epoxy flooring cost in Stacyville, Iowa?

Residential garages typically run $4 to $10 per square foot installed, depending on finish complexity and prep needed. A two-car garage usually lands between $1,800 and $4,500. The phone quote is firm before any deposit is taken.
